GRE Vocab Challenge

Tuesday, December 9th, 2008

Last week I decided that I want to take the GRE next month. Obviously that
leaves me with very little time to study. Instead of stressing or trying to
cram hours of studying in each day, I decided to come up with a manageable
plan and just do the best I can.

The main focus of my study plan will be studying vocabulary words, so I’m challenging myself to learn 20 words a day for 30 days. (more…)
